About this role
Assist in designing and developing engaging training content, including e-learning modules, presentations, and handouts. Support the scheduling, participant registration, logistics, and follow-up of training programs, workshops, and learning events. Provide general administrative support to the L&D team, including maintaining training records and updating databases. Support the administration of the Learning Management System (LMS), including uploading courses and tracking learner progress. Perform other ad-hoc tasks and projects as assigned by the supervisor. Requirements Year 2 to 4 undergraduate student pursuing a degree in Human Resources, Business, Management, Psychology, Social Sciences, or related disciplines.…
